Lambing Day

Spring Has Arrived and The Spicy Lamb Farm is a favourite place to visit! Visit the farm and see newborn lambs, ducklings, and bunnies.

Our April events tend to get very crowed. Please plan ahead for ride sharing, parking, and walking. We will have a policeman to direct traffic, but remember to turn around at the dead end of the road and park heading out. We have had folks park as far away as Camp Ledgewood so be very careful of children on the road. You can also drop the young and old at the driveway. Just please don’t create a traffic jam. This year, due to our family schedule, we can only have one Lambing Day. Please help keep an eye on your children that they are gentle with our babies so they do not get overwhelmed! Everyone will get a chance to enjoy the lambs, ducklings, and bunnies. Please be patient and make sure the children are gentle. It is also a muddy mess after such a mild winter so please dress for the farm.

 

ADMISSION INFO

Admission is $10 for adults and $5 for children. We take cash or checks for admission and shopping in the farm shop but aren’t set up for credit cards. Admission is our fundraiser to pay for hay and capital improvements for the flock.

If you are a frequent farm visitor, you might want to consider, a Season Pass or the Adopt a Sheep & Watch your Blanket Grow which includes a season pass, your opportunity to help shear, and a custom blanket. Email us with questions.
